Summary:
Fully furnished cabin has everything you need for an easy stay. Enjoy awe inspiring views of the badlands from the front porch. This 2BR comfortably sleeps 6 with 1 queen size bed, 2 twin beds and a pull out queen sofa. Guests share 1B with shower/tub combo. Kitchen comes with daily essentials. Minutes to everything Medora has to offer. Bring your horse, bike, and golf clubs. We look forward to your visit!

This cabin is in an RV Campground. There may be a camper parked close to the cabin.
